It is defined as the systematic way of representing the data that follows a certain rule of arithmetic.
For the first sequence:
2, 4, 6, 8, 10
The above sequence represents the arithmetic sequence
The common difference = 4 -2 = 8 - 6 = 2
For the second series:
1, 2, 3, 4, 5
The above sequence represents the arithmetic sequence
The common difference = 2 -1 = 4 - 3 = 1
Thus, the first series is an arithmetic sequence with a common difference 2, for the second series is an arithmetic sequence with a common difference 1.
